How to Tell If Your NOx Sensor Is Failing: Symptoms, Fault Codes & Replacement Guide

A NOx sensor (nitrogen oxide sensor) is a key emissions component on modern diesel trucks, buses, and off-road engines. It measures the level of NOx in the exhaust stream so the engine control unit (ECU) can regulate the selective catalytic reduction (SCR) and exhaust gas recirculation (EGR) systems. When the sensor drifts out of spec or fails, the vehicle loses the feedback it needs to control emissions β€” which usually triggers a warning light, reduced performance, or a failed emissions test.

This guide explains how a NOx sensor works, the six most common failure symptoms, the OBD-II fault codes you are likely to see, what causes the failure, how to diagnose it, and how to choose the correct replacement for your application.

What Does a NOx Sensor Do?

Most diesel applications use two NOx sensors: one upstream (before the SCR catalyst) and one downstream (after it). Each sensor reports real-time NOx concentration (in ppm) to the ECU. The control unit compares the two readings to calculate conversion efficiency and adjust DEF (AdBlue/Urea) dosing, injection timing, and EGR rate. A reliable NOx sensor is what keeps the engine inside legal emissions limits while protecting fuel economy and power.

6 Common Symptoms of a Failing NOx Sensor

  • 1. Check Engine or Emissions Warning Light. The most obvious sign. A faulty sensor usually sets a fault code that illuminates the dashboard lamp.
  • 2. Reduced Fuel Economy. Without accurate NOx feedback, the ECU often runs a richer or more conservative strategy, increasing diesel consumption.
  • 3. Loss of Power / Limp Mode. Many engines enter a protective “limp home” state when NOx control is lost, capping RPM and speed.
  • 4. Failed Emissions or Smoke Test. Inaccurate sensor data can push NOx output above the limit, failing mandatory testing.
  • 5. Abnormal DEF / Urea Consumption. A drifting sensor can cause over- or under-dosing of DEF, leading to crystallisation or excessive fluid use.
  • 6. Visible Exhaust Smoke or Odour. Poor closed-loop control can let unburnt or high-NOx exhaust pass through.

Common NOx Sensor Fault Codes (OBD-II)

NOx sensor faults fall in the P2200–P229F range. The exact code depends on the bank, sensor position (upstream/downstream), and manufacturer, but the pattern is consistent:

Code Family Meaning
P2200 / P2201 / P2202 / P2203 NOx Sensor Circuit (Bank 1, Sensor 1) β€” range/performance, signal, low, high
P2209 / P2210 / P2211 / P2212 NOx Sensor Heater Control Circuit (Bank 1, Sensor 1)
P229F / P229E NOx Sensor Exhaust Sample Cross Count / Circuit (Bank 1, Sensor 2)
P22xx (Sensor 2) Downstream sensor circuit / heater faults (after SCR catalyst)

Note: code definitions vary by manufacturer (Mercedes, Cummins, Volvo, etc.). Always confirm against the specific OEM fault tree before replacing parts.

What Causes NOx Sensor Failure?

  • Contamination. Oil ash, soot, coolant, or fuel residue coats the sensing element and degrades accuracy.
  • Thermal Shock. Repeated extreme temperature swings crack the ceramic and the internal heating element.
  • Moisture Ingress. Failed seals or connector corrosion short the sensor circuitry.
  • Age & Mileage. Like any emissions sensor, NOx sensors wear and drift after years of service.
  • Wiring & Connector Damage. A broken harness or corroded plug can mimic a sensor failure.

How to Diagnose a Bad NOx Sensor

  1. Read the fault codes with an OBD-II or OEM-grade scanner to identify which sensor and circuit is flagged.
  2. Check live data. Compare upstream vs. downstream NOx ppm readings; a stuck, flat, or implausible value points to the faulty sensor.
  3. Inspect the wiring and connector for corrosion, melting, or loose pins before assuming the sensor itself is bad.
  4. Verify heater circuit with a multimeter if a heater-related code is present.

How to Choose the Right Replacement NOx Sensor

Choosing the correct unit comes down to four checks:

  • Match the OE number exactly. The stamped OE reference is the most reliable way to guarantee fitment and protocol.
  • Confirm brand & model year. Sensor calibration differs between Mercedes, Cummins, Volvo, Scania, DAF/PACCAR, Hyundai, and others.
  • Pick the correct position. Upstream and downstream sensors are not always interchangeable.
  • Verify quality. Use OEM-equivalent sensors with the right connector, cable length, and heater spec.

Frequently Asked Questions

Can I keep driving with a bad NOx sensor?
Short distances may be possible, but most engines limit power or block regeneration once the fault is active. Continuing to drive risks higher emissions, poor fuel economy, and potential damage to the SCR system.

OEM or aftermarket?
A high-quality OEM-equivalent sensor with the correct protocol and connector is usually the best balance of reliability and cost. Always match the OE number first.

How long does a NOx sensor last?
Typically 80,000–150,000 km under normal duty, but harsh duty cycles, contamination, and thermal stress can shorten that significantly.
